POPUPtober: Boss
CUTober: Mermaid
Who is the boss of mermaids? Neptune, rising from the seas, bedecked with seaweed. The mermaids are implied as they are all cowering out of sight. The jellyfish have no such fears.

Who is the boss of mermaids? Neptune, rising from the seas, bedecked with seaweed. The mermaids are implied as they are all cowering out of sight. The jellyfish have no such fears.